2025年stringnull(2025年stringnull比较)
nullstring怎么解决
1、解决 nullstring 问题可从不同编程语言入手,采取多种方法避免异常,提升代码健壮性。
2、固态硬盘显示nullstring表明系统无法识别并访问固态硬盘,因此无法检索数据。根据查询相关公开信息显示为,Nullstring是电脑硬件系统识别不到固态硬盘的一种表示,表明系统无法识别并访问固态硬盘,因此无法检索数据。
3、游戏服务器问题。游戏服务器出现故障或维护,导致无法成功登录,可以尝试稍后再次尝试登录,或者联系游戏的官方支持团队以获取更多信息。
4、解决NullPointerException可采用以下方法:检查对象初始化:要保证在调用对象的方法或者访问其属性之前,对象已经被正确实例化。例如,使用String s = new String();来创建对象,而不是仅声明String s;,因为未初始化的对象直接使用时就可能抛出空指针异常。
5、解决NullPointerException异常可按以下步骤进行:定位异常位置查看异常堆栈信息,像at Demo2test.main(test.java:38)这种,能确定具体出错的代码行。在Java 14及以上版本,可通过JEP 358增强异常信息,不过编译时要添加-g参数生成调试信息,这样能直接提示哪个变量为null。

forinputstringnull中文翻译
1、“for input string null”的中文翻译是“对于输入字符串为空”。这个短语通常出现在编程或软件开发的上下文中,用于描述当某个函数或方法期望接收一个字符串作为输入,但实际上接收到的是“null”或“空”值时所发生的情况。在编程中,“null”通常表示一个变量没有被赋值,或者一个对象不存在。
2、“for input string null”的中文翻译是“对于输入字符串为空”。这个短语在编程或软件开发的上下文中经常出现,具体含义包括以下几点:错误描述:当某个函数或方法期望接收一个字符串作为输入,但实际上接收到的是“null”或“空”值时,会触发这个错误。
Java空字符串与null的区别和判断字符串是否为空的方法
Java空字符串与null的区别:类型 null表示的是一个对象的值,而并不是一个字符串。例如声明一个对象的引用,String a = null ;表示的是一个空字符串,也就是说它的长度为0。
在Java中,null与空字符串 之间存在着重要的区别,这一差异类似于数字0与没有的概念并不相同。null表示一个空对象,而 则代表一个空字符串。具体来说,null可以被赋值给任何类型的对象,这意味着它可以用来表示一个对象尚未初始化或该对象已被释放。
第一种方法是使用equals方法比较字符串。例如:String s = ;if (.equals(s) { } 这种方法确保了即使s是一个null引用,也不会抛出NullPointerException。然而,这种做法在每次调用时都需要进行额外的比较操作,这可能会影响性能。第二种方法是直接检查字符串是否为null。
空字符串对象null的值和内存地址都不相等。
使用param == null检查param是否为null,如果是,则直接返回true。 使用param.isEmpty()检查param是否为空字符串,如果是,则返回true。 使用param.length() = 0检查param的长度是否为0,如果是,则返回true。
if (str == null || str.isEmpty() { },这里的 str.isEmpty()方法同样可以判断字符串是否为空,且适用于Java 6及更高版本。对于空字符串的判断,还可以考虑使用正则表达式进行检查,例如 if (str.matches(^$) { },这种方法可以确保字符串完全为空,但使用场景较少。
Java如何判断String为空和不为空
在Java中判断一个String对象是否为空,可以通过多种方式实现。最直接的方法是检查对象是否为null,即 str == null,这表示String对象还未指向任何特定的字符串。另一种方法是检查字符串的长度是否为0,即 str.equals()。
在Java中判断字符串是否为空值时,可以使用如下的代码片段:如果(WightUser.getText()==null || (WightUser.getText().equals()。然而,这种方式不会检查字符串是否仅为空格。
第一种方法是使用equals方法比较字符串。例如:String s = ;if (.equals(s) { } 这种方法确保了即使s是一个null引用,也不会抛出NullPointerException。然而,这种做法在每次调用时都需要进行额外的比较操作,这可能会影响性能。第二种方法是直接检查字符串是否为null。
首先就要确保他不是null,然后再判断他的长度。 String str = xxx; if(str != null && str.length() != 0) { } 这种做法是安全的,首先他会判断str是否为空,如果为空那么if就直接退出了,就不会再判断后面的str.length() != 0了,这是JAVA的&&特性,也许其他语言也是这样。
isEmpty()方法仅判断字符串是否为空,不考虑字符串中是否包含空白字符。isBlank()方法不仅判断字符串是否为空,还判断字符串是否仅包含空白字符。在Java 11及更高版本中,可以使用isBlank()方法来简化对字符串是否为空或仅包含空白字符的验证,而无需再使用String.trim()和String.isEmpty()的组合。